2025 Emmy Awards: ‘Severance‘ Dominates in a Night of Triumphs

Los Angeles, CA – The 77th annual Emmy Awards concluded Sunday evening, marking a significant moment in television history as streaming platforms and traditional broadcasters battled for recognition. The ceremony, hosted by comedian Nate Bargatze, aimed for a lighthearted tone amidst current events, with the host explicitly stating his intention to avoid political commentary. The evening’s biggest victor was “Severance,” which secured an notable 27 nominations, solidifying its position as a critical and popular favorite.

Streamers and Cable Clash for Television Supremacy

The competition between streaming giants and established cable networks was fierce. HBO, a long-standing force in prestige television, garnered over 50 nominations for acclaimed series like “The White Lotus,” “The Penguin,” and “The Last of Us.” However, it was “Severance” that ultimately led the pack, showcasing the growing influence of streaming services in the television landscape. broadcast networks and basic cable also made their mark with nominations for shows such as “Abbott Elementary” and “The Bear”, but the top accolade belonged to a streaming title.

Key Winners of the Evening

The Emmy Awards celebrated excellence across various categories. “Abbott Elementary” took home the prize for Outstanding Comedy Series, while “Severance” was crowned Outstanding drama Series. “Black mirror” was recognized as the Outstanding Limited or Anthology Series, and “The Amazing Race” earned the title of Outstanding Reality Competition program. Individual accolades were also presented, acknowledging outstanding performances. Notable winners included Adam Brody and Ayo Edebiri for their roles in comedy, and Sterling K. brown and Britt Lower recognized for their dramatic performances. Colin Farrell and Cate Blanchett were celebrated for their leading roles in limited series.

Directing and Writing Excellence Honored

The awards also celebrated the creative forces behind the screen. Ayo Edebiri and Ben stiller were among the winners for Outstanding Directing, while Quinta Brunson and Dan Erickson were recognized for their exceptional writing.The Emmy Awards acknowledge exceptional storytelling.
